AR Technologies appoints Panmarine to support WindWings® growth in Greece and Cyprus

29.05.2026

BAR Technologies has appointed Panmarine & Industrial Services Ltd. as its commercial consultant for Greece, Cyprus and connected territories, strengthening its regional presence as wind propulsion moves into wider adoption as a practical fuel-saving and vessel efficiency measure.

The announcement comes ahead of Posidonia 2026, where the global maritime community will gather in Athens against a backdrop of fuel price pressure, regulatory uncertainty and growing interest in practical vessel efficiency technologies.

It also follows the recent WindWings® installations on Union Maritime’s Brands Hatch, Spa and Monza, and comes as BAR Technologies moves from first commercial deployments towards wider market adoption, with 13 WindWings® now fitted across five vessels, and four more WindWings® powered vessels to be launched before the end of 2026

Based in Piraeus, Panmarine & Industrial Services Ltd. is well established in the Greek maritime market, representing international engineering and industrial technology companies across the marine sector. The company will work with BAR Technologies to engage with owners, operators and technical teams across Greece and Cyprus.

Developed using BAR Technologies’ expertise in advanced simulation, aerodynamics and high-performance engineering, WindWings® are designed to deliver measurable fuel savings through wind-assisted propulsion.

WindWings® now carry class validation from Bureau Veritas and DNV, alongside Lloyd’s Register approval for its P-Wind power calculation methodology, underlining its readiness for wider retrofit and newbuild deployment.

For shipowners weighing fuel cost, vessel performance and changing regulatory requirements, wind remains the only propulsion source that is free at source, available on the route and requires no new fuel infrastructure. WindWings® turn that available energy into measurable vessel efficiency gains.

About BAR Technologies

With an impressive heritage, having spun out of Great Britain’s former America’s Cup Team, BAR Technologies provides a wide range of design and engineering consultancy services across commercial ships, workboats, leisure boats, and engineered solutions. The company boasts a team of world-leading naval architects, optimisation specialists, fluid dynamists, and system engineers, all focused on delivering next-generation maritime technology. 

About WindWings® 

BAR Technologies’ patented three-element wing design is unique in the marketplace, delivering 2.5 times the lift of a single-element wing. Unlike other wind-assisted propulsion systems, WindWings® require no continuous power for suction fans or mechanical spinning. They automatically adjust camber and angle of attack for optimised efficiency at the most angles and wind speeds, offering a proven, scalable solution for emissions reduction. 

Offering on average 1.5 tonnes of fuel saving per WindWing® per day, the 37.5m WindWings® has taken its place as the most powerful wind-assisted technology on the market.
